Sunil Nair is a condensed matter experimentalist and a Professor of Physics at IISER Pune https://www.iiserpune.ac.in/research/department/physics/people/faculty/regular-faculty/sunil-nair/307 He and his research group explore various topics, including Multiferroics | Transition metal oxides | Unconventional superconductors | Low temperature instrumentation | Non-linear magnetic susceptibility | Spin Caloritronics.   In this episode, we discussed: ·         His intellectual journey ·         Growing up in Pune ·         Student days at Pune University ·         His experience of working in Indore, Dresden and Oxford ·         Jugalbandi of experiments and theory ·         Elements of a good talk and good writing ·         Big science from small labs ·         Quantum ihub at IISER Pune ·         New development in spintronics, including superfluid state ·         Many related topics  Listen as we humanize science.     References: [1]“Sunil Nair - IISER Pune.” Accessed: Sep. 05, 2024.
